Beberapa paket lagi untuk ditambahkan ke saran Chl tentang Pemrosesan untuk membuat visualisasi interaktif. Semua ini berbasis javascript dan dapat berjalan di browser, sehingga dapat digunakan untuk penerbitan serta untuk analisis Anda sendiri:
- D3.js adalah penerus Protovis. Ini lebih kuat karena Anda memiliki kontrol lebih besar atas objek yang dibuat (mereka adalah objek DOM yang tepat, yaitu Anda memiliki kontrol penuh atas mereka menggunakan javascript), tetapi beberapa lebih suka Protovis untuk kesederhanaan. Baik diskusi teknis D3 vs Protovis di sini .
- Raphael.js adalah pilihan yang baik untuk interaktivitas web pasar massal yang sangat tersesuaikan karena keduanya merupakan bukti di masa depan (tanpa flash) dan berfungsi pada peramban setua IE6 (satu-satunya yang tidak berfungsi pada yang saya tahu adalah versi lama dari browser Android). Seperti D3, semuanya adalah objek DOM yang dapat ditargetkan dan memiliki kontrol api yang baik untuk animasi dan interaktivitas. Ini tidak menawarkan apa-apa di luar kotak yang khusus untuk visualisasi: itu adalah batu tulis kosong yang sangat kuat dan fleksibel, pilihan yang bagus untuk merancang visualisasi khusus tetapi tidak untuk analisis eksplorasi awal Anda sendiri. Kenali data Anda terlebih dahulu.
- gRaphael.js adalah bagan standar (bar, baris, dll) untuk Raphael. Ini dasar tetapi berfungsi dan dapat dibangun di atas - mungkin merupakan bahan yang berguna jika Anda membangun suite Anda sendiri.
Mengenai pertanyaan Anda yang lain tentang belajar, untuk prinsip-prinsip umum, Desain Dashboard Informasi layak disebutkan, jika apa yang Anda inginkan adalah membuat array alat standar interaktif tujuan umum untuk data Anda.
Visualisasi interaktif berada di garis antara statistik dan desain interaktivitas : jadi buku yang dapat digunakan. Saya tidak memiliki pengalaman pribadi dari banyak buku teks desain interaksi, tapi saya penggemar berat Prinsip Universal Desain . Mungkin berlebihan untuk kebutuhan Anda, tetapi pertimbangkan untuk melihat ke bawah kolom Kegunaan dalam halaman Konten Kategorikal yang sangat baik dan membaca bab-bab yang tercantum (pengungkapan progresif, sinyal ke noise, dll).
Juga, bagi siapa pun yang baru dalam pemrograman, Pemrograman Interaktivitas adalah tempat yang baik untuk memulai meningkatkan keterampilan teknis (juga termasuk bab besar tentang Pemrosesan).
Tetapi untuk mengetahui apa yang berhasil dan apa yang mungkin, Anda tidak dapat mengalahkan belajar sambil melakukan , dan awal yang baik bisa mempertimbangkan untuk mengikuti dan menganalisa paket visualisasi interaktif tujuan besar big-price-tag-nama besar seperti tableau dan jmp , dan pikirkan mengapa fitur-fitur mereka dirancang sebagaimana adanya.